William Eccles

Birthabt 1771 - Watercourse, Cork, Ireland
Death1846 -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land
MotherMary Casey
FatherWilliam Eccles

Born in Watercourse, Cork, Ireland on abt 1771 to William Eccles and Mary Casey. William Eccles married Mary Robertson and had 14 children. He passed away on 1846 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land.
